Paperback. Condición: New. Print on Demand. This book reviews engineering work in Montana from 1913 to 1914. It details the development of engineering projects like the building of railways, dams, irrigation systems, and mining operations. The author provides an in-depth view into many aspects of engineering present during this…period within the state. They also discuss the broader context of the engineering taking place in the state, from the use of United States resources to the development of hydroelectric power. Some Montana-based projects are presented as examples of national engineering trends, such as the Milwaukee Road's electrification of 440 miles of its main line. The book brings to light engineering trends that continue to be relevant to the field today, making it a valuable historical record of the development of engineering and its impact in Montana.
